PHP callbacks for ajax calls

Hi.

There is a problem with asy_jpcache I’m trying to solve. The problem is that the cache is not cleared when you modify an article (textpattern 4.5.5). The plugin register for some callbacks when something changes on the admin side, but it seems no event is fired when the new ajax call is performed.

Question for the core devs: Is it planned to add callbacks for ajax calls in a future release?

Re: PHP callbacks for ajax calls

Ok, now I see the events ARE fired. It is a problem with the plugin type. It must be Admin + Public (+AJAX). Forget my question ;-)
